As a Workshop Systems Technician your duties will be covering Workshop Systems builds; manufacturing of Acoem monitoring systems, assisting with sourcing and specifying suitable components, assisting the manufacturing workshop with all documentation needs, and quality compliance of systems.
Key responsibilities include:- The integration and manufacturing of systems.
- Reading and interpretation of engineering drawings.
- Problem solving and communication of issues or improvements to engineers.
- Catering for all workshop engineering tasks.
- Organisation of parts handling during manufacture stage.
- Maintaining production manufacturing equipment.
- General factory maintenance.
- Completing basic service repairs to systems & instruments.
- Maintaining workshop OH&S standards.
- Transporting, packaging, using and manual handling sensitive electronic equipment and tools in a responsible and safe manner.
